2017-10-12 193 views
0

我有兩個活動profile_ActivityEdit_Profile_activity當我從移動到Profile_ActivityEdit_Profile_activity上做一些配置文件修改和更新配置文件更新,活動成功更新,但更新後的值不當按下移動的後退按鈕時顯示在profile_Activity上。在按UpEnabled按鈕時也顯示該值。不會得到新的數據

+0

活動使吸氣劑setter.set價值的共同類從編輯活動並獲得個人資料的活動值。 –

+0

如何更新您的個人檔案活動 – Rahul

+0

@Rahul m使用Volley響應方法更新按鈕點擊偵聽器 –

回答

2

開始使用

Intent intent = new Intent(mActivity, Edit_Profile_activity.class); 
startActivityForResult(intent, REQUEST_CODE); 


@Override 
    protected void onActivityResult(int requestCode, int resultCode, Intent data) { 
     super.onActivityResult(requestCode, resultCode, data); 
     switch (requestCode) { 
      case REQUEST_CODE: 
       if (resultCode == Activity.RESULT_OK && data!=null) { 
        String abc=data.getStringExtra("data_key") ;    
        //write your code for update info 
       } 
       break; 
     } 
    } 

在你Edit_Profile_activity返回結果通過

Intent intent=new Intent(); 
intent.putExtra("data_key",value); 
setResult(Activity.RESULT_OK, intent); 
finish();